What Are Rare Earth Elements?
Rare Earth Elements are a group of 17 chemically similar metals, including:
- Lanthanides (e.g., neodymium, europium, lanthanum, cerium)
- Scandium
- Yttrium
They are vital for modern manufacturing and research. Although called “rare,” these elements are relatively abundant but difficult to extract and refine, making their supply critical.
Applications of Rare Earth Elements
- Technology: Smartphones, hard drives, and touchscreens
- Energy: Wind turbines and electric car motors
- Defense: Guided missiles, satellites, and military optics
- Medical: MRI contrast agents and cancer treatments
- Research: Catalysts in industrial chemistry and biotech labs
